Request ID: 23-06-1470
Published: 20.06.2023

KS vil i samarbeid med medlemmene arbeide for å utvikle Fiks-plattformen til en sentral plattform for kommunesektoren og sammen med andre plattformer etter hvert utgjøre et felles offentlig økosystem. For at dette skal fungere i praksis må økosystemet styres på en samordnet måte og innholdet som inngår i det må være koordinert.

Hovedelementene i et felles økosystem slik KS ser det vil være:

  • Standardiserte forretningsmodeller og avtaleverk
  • Harmoniserte finansierings- og betalingsmodeller
  • Felles arkitekturer, for eksempel referansearkitekturer, standarder, veiledninger og rammeverk
  • Standardiserte innganger for de ulike brukerne
  • Felles datakilder, for eksempel masterdata og grunndataregistre
  • Fellesløsninger

Fiks-plattformen er bygget på en Openshift løsning, hvor de fleste tjenester er utviklet i Java/Kotlin. Vi benytter følgende databaser til forskjellige tjenester: PostgreSQL, Microsoft SQL Server, MySQL, MongoDB, Eventstore, Elasticsearch. Vi har logging via ELK. Fiks-plattformen har mye sensitive data, derfor er kryptering og sikring viktig. Vi benytter Digdir sin autentiserings- løsning. Denne løsningen bygger på OpenID Connect (OIDC). Frontend kode er laget i Angular og Typescript primært.

Krav
KS har behov for inntil 4 java/kotlin systemutviklere til å utvikle nye tjenester og vedlikeholde eksisterende tjenester på Fiks plattformen, eksempelvis SvarUt, DHIS2, og Fiks folkeregister. 
Vi har behov for konsulenter som er dyktige programmerere i Java og Kotlin. Det er en fordel om konsulentene har erfaring fra SvarUt, DHIS2 og modernisert folkeregister.

Det samlede teamet må ha kompetanse innen:

  • Openshift/Kubernetes
  • Linux
  • Docker
  • Helm
  • Eventsourcing
  • Automatisert testing
  • Nginx
  • Rest servicer med spesifikasjon i OpenAPI

Databaser:

  • SQL-databaser, PostgreSQL, Microsoft SQL Server, MySQL/MariaDB
  • MongoDB
  • Eventstore
  • Elasticsearch
  • Produkter:
  • Grafana
  • Prometheus Kibana
  • Jenkins

I tillegg er det en fordel med kompetanse på:

  • OpenID Connect
  • Lua
  • HaPRoxy
  • Openidc i openresty
  • RabbitMQ
  • .NET, C#
  • Kjennskap til kommunal sektor er en fordel.

Required skills:
Java Kotlin Kubernetes Linux Docker

Desired skills:
OpenID RabbitMQ SQL

Competence area

Development

Location

Bergen

Workload

100%

Languages

Norsk

Startdate

01.09.2023

Enddate

29.02.2024

Apply before

07.08.2023

Deadline for compliance

24.08.2023

Contact person:
Marthon Hermansen
Sourcing Manager
Similar assignments

iOS-utvikler til YR

Request ID: 25-06-8361 Published: 2025-06-17

Yr/NRK søker en senior iOS-utvikler med solid erfaring i utvikling av native-applikasjoner.  Konsulenten vil få ansvar for videreutvikling og forvaltning av Yr sin iOS-app sammen med en annen iOS utvikler på teamet, og være en sentral fagperson i arbeidet med brukeropplevelse, ytelse og kodekvalitet. NRK har behov for bistand til vedlikehold, omskriving og videreutvikling av Yr app på iOS. Konsulententen skal bistå eksisterende iOS utvikler på teamet i arbeidet og rapporterer i sitt daglige virk......

Competence area
Development
Location
NRK Marienlyst Oslo
Workload
100%
Startdate
2025-08-11
Enddate
2025-12-31
Can prolong
Languages
Norsk
Apply before: 22-06-2025 16:00

UX- Designer til Team Produkt (Videreføring av en eksisterende rolle)

Request ID: 25-06-2646 Published: 2025-06-12

Entur AS har behov for 1 UX-designer til team Produkt. UX-designeren vil ha ansvar for alt teamets designarbeid, og utføre mesteparten av dette selv. Team Produkt er et fullstack-team som utvikler og forvalter den nasjonale pris- og produktdatabasen (nasjonal fellestjeneste), samt tilhørende grensesnitt for administrering av pris- og produktdata. Teamet har ansvaret for et komplekst domene med flere applikasjoner og tjenester som konsumeres av interne klienter i Entur og eksterne aktører via mas......

Competence area
Design
Location
Oslo
Workload
100%
Startdate
2025-08-04
Enddate
2028-08-04
Can prolong
Languages
Norsk
Apply before: 22-06-2025 12:00